ok so i have anthems, have always had turntables on them, but i know these are expensive and hard to find so most people dont want to go with that option. if you can, find some p12s, either pivot or turntable heel. that is what i have on my anthems. with the small mounting platform they are sick for that skis. if thats not an option, go with some mojo 15s. super light and durable binding, highly underrated. this years have a 15 deg. pivot heel, next year dont so take your pick what you want. i personally always stay away from salomon, marker, and the px series. salomons are wayyyyy too expensive for what you get (even sth 16s), markers are crap besides like jesters, and i just have never had good experiences with px's, and i think you said you didnt like them anyway. well i hope something in here is helpful...

Ideally a pair of P12 Jibs or Axial 120s or any pivot binding really. However they are getting more and more rare, so I think a pair of new Scratch 120s would be more than enough for you. The all white would look really nice on the Anthems too.
 
He said he doesnt like his apparently broken or mis-adjusted axial 120s. If he doesnt like the weight of them and is having pre-release issues then there isnt really any helping him. You could try some STH 12s I suppose, but from my experience they dont have nearly the same reliability and are just not that much binding for the money when compared to Rossi/Looks in a similar din range.
 
ya well idk i kinda wanted to try something new from my axial 120's so i will prolly look into the tyrolia's since every1 saying they are making good bindings lately
 
They do, but a pair of Mojo 15s is going to feel very heavy if you think your Axial 120s are at all hefty. At your weight though you might be able to get away with the Mojo 11s. I dont have any experience with them though so i cant really comment.
